Pourquoi le document « Commencer à développer des applications iOS (Swift) » n’est-il plus mis à jour ? Où puis-je trouver la plus récente documentation officielle pour démarrer le développement iOS ? Artboard


HAHAHAHAHAHAHAHAH

*dies*


Oh, mec...

La doc iOS ne sera jamais mise à jour.

Ok, elle le sera. Mais pas très bientôt.

Chaque développeur iOS a dû supporter les docs merdiques et obsolètes d'Apple depuis des temps immémoriaux. Cela signifie que vous devez le faire aussi. Voyez cela comme un rite de passage.

En tout cas, ce document est parfaitement bien comme tutoriel de démarrage.

Je ne sais pas pourquoi vous pensez que juste parce que quelque chose n'est pas continuellement mis à jour, il devient automatiquement inutile. J'ai trouvé une grande partie de la merde d'Apple du début des années 2010 utile !

En tout cas, cette page est le tutoriel que je recommande toujours aux gens ici. C'est en fait un très bon tutoriel. Aucun de ses éléments ne va jamais changer. Il vous enseigne des principes fondamentaux qui existent, plus ou moins, depuis que le développement d'applications iOS est une chose. Sérieusement.

Vous devez vous rappeler que la grande majorité des "changements" qu'Apple déploie ne sont que des modifications de la syntaxe Swift. C'est parce que Swift est un nouveau langage (et un langage assez aggravant pour travailler, si je suis honnête), et qu'ils ne savent pas comment se fixer sur un seul style de syntaxe.

Donc, quand Apple dit "cette doc n'est plus mise à jour" (ce qui est très gentil de leur part, d'habitude ils l'abandonnent tranquillement sans le dire à personne), prenez-le simplement pour dire que le code Swift que vous greffez à partir de ce document peut ou non compiler du premier coup à l'avenir. C'est très facile à corriger ; Xcode s'en occupe généralement pour vous.

Oh, et si vous pensez que c'est dépassé... oh , attendez de commencer à passer au peigne fin le reste des docs d'Apple... de nombreux guides de programmation Apple plus anciens sont encore écrits en Objective-C vieilli, et ils ne seront pas mis à jour de sitôt.

.